- Do not read past this point to avoid spoilers -
Getting past the salvage teams is in fact the easiest part of the mission, but it is wise to avoid hurling your units blindly at the enemy teams. By Mission 8, you should be aware of what units have what abilities/strengths/weaknesses so you are capable of distinguishing what units to use against certain enemy units.
Some of the first teams consist mostly of infantry and a larger vehicle such as an Eclipse tank. Use the Kazuars to take out the infantry (light infantry to remove enemies like Tank Hunters) and then send in your Goliaths to eradicate any heavy units like Flame Tanks, Eclipse Tanks, Hammerheads etc. Every time you kill an enemy salvage team, you will receive reinforcements, so if you save enough of your units, this shouldn't be a big problem.
A little tip for getting past the last salvage teams: In the bottom left corner of the map, there are some scattered enemy infantry. Use your Kazuars to kill whatever infantry you find and proceed to the very corner of the map, if all enemies have been cleared out and the path is safe, you will receive some heavy reinforcements (3-5 Goliaths, if I remember correctly) at that location. This will give you more than enough firepower to plow through the rest of the teams.
Once you beat the salvage teams and proceed a little to the north, the enemy base and final objectives will be revealed. The defenses in this base are hard to penetrate, but your best bet is aircraft, MLRS Walkers and the newly introduced Siege Infantry to break through the lines of defense.

But I digress. I did it by building an assload of walls and putting pavement everywhere I could to mitigate the destructive potential of the AI's artillery. I then focused on bringing down the enemy construction yard and war factory using Orcas. Once that was done, I used jumpjets and Orcas to take out the remaining artillery guarding the south side of the base, and slowly chipped away at the other defenses with siege infantry. Once the artillery is out of the picture for good, it's practically in the bag. _________________
